Question Image Converter

Ok i made a copy of one of my games with nero. and I wanted to know if there was a program where I could convert it to ISO or BIN. I would use DDump or something similar but it took extremely long to copy it. So if here is a way around this and you know where i can d/l a program of the such thne please tell me where. in the mean time i am searching gogle for somethingl ike it.

His problem is that Nero uses a non standard ISO file system that ePSXe doesn't support
The number of sectors are incorrect as well as a couple other differences.
